In the biomechanics sector, ADDG is a leader in its own right. They pioneered the Variable Resistance Beam (VRB) and developed a portfolio of patented human augmentation products around this technology. SelectFlex is ADDG’s first commercial product introduction, and the only dynamic arch control insoles of their kind. VRB technology is the foundation of the SelectFlex PowerBeam™ and PowerLift Arch™ dynamic arch lifting system, which offers three comfort settings for any foot type to help correct alignment and provide pain relief from a variety of lower extremity issues. ABOUT ADDG

Alliance Design & Development Group’s (ADDG) was founded in 2016 with the mission to help people lead pain-free lives through advanced wellness technologies, intuitive interfaces, and assistive human augmentation solutions with long-term therapeutic benefits. ADDG created SelectFlex® in collaboration with Langer Biomechanics of Orthotic Holdings, Inc. (OHI), a leader in lower extremity condition treatments. www.selectflex.com
